Wingspan: 960mm(37.8in)
Overall length: 1020mm(40.15in)
Flying weight: ~ 1900g
Motor size: 2860-KV1850
Wing load: 107g/dm²(0.25oz/in²)
Wing area: 17.7dm²(274.35sq.in)
ESC: 70A
Servo: 9g Servo x 8
Recommended battery: 6S 3300mAh-4000mAh
Li-Po 35C

The Boeing T-45 Goshawk is a highly modified version of the
British BAE Systems Hawk land-based training jet aircraft. The
T-45 is used by the United States Navy as an aircraft
carrier-capable trainer.
Following the success of the BAE Hawk, FMS is proud to bring
you this new and highly detailed 70mm T-45. Incorporating
many advanced construction and assembly methods such as
integrated wing set and multi-connector, the T-45 is easily
assembled and disassembled. Building on the success of the
BAE Hawk, the T-45 features rich details, clean lines,
CNC-machined shock-absorbing landing gears, removable
arresting hook and a latch-type canopy hatch.
A great airframe requires a competent power system, so FMS
has selected the efficient, powerful and reliable 70mm
12-blade EDF with a 1850KV motor- which provides fantastic
thrust when coupled with a 6S power system, while providing a
turbine -like engine note.

Key Features:
·High quality Predator 70A ESC, powerful 1850KV in-runner
motor with the latest 70mm 12-blade EDF
·Fast assembly wing structure with a dedicated connector s
ystem
·CNC-machined shock-absorbing landing gear sets
·Intuitive, easy-to-assemble construction.
·Fully functional flaps
·Latch-type canopy hatch
